Common types of book binding explained

Several core book binding types are widely used across industries. Each offers distinct advantages depending on the application.

Case binding for hardcover books is one of the most durable options. It uses sewn pages attached to rigid boards, often covered in cloth or laminated paper. This method is common for textbooks and high-value books because it offers long-term strength.

Perfect binding books are a popular softcover option. Pages are glued to a flat spine, creating a clean, professional look. This method is widely used for catalogs and paperbacks, though it does not open flat and may wear over time.

Saddle stitch binding is simple and cost-effective. Folded sheets are stapled along the spine, making it ideal for brochures and short booklets. It works best for lower page counts and lighter use.

Spiral coil binding for books use a coil threaded through punched holes. This allows pages to rotate fully, making it useful for manuals and notebooks. Wire-O binding books offer a similar function with a more polished appearance.

Smyth sewn binding is known for durability. Pages are sewn in sections before being glued into the cover, creating a flexible and long-lasting structure. It is one of the most reliable durable book binding methods for projects that require frequent handling.

How to choose the right binding method

Selecting the best book binding method for durability and cost requires balancing several factors. The right choice depends on how the book will be used and how long it needs to last.

Durability is often the first consideration. Sewn and case-bound books provide the strongest structure for long-term use. Smyth sewn binding offers excellent strength and flexibility, while adhesive methods like perfect binding are better for medium-term use.

Page count also matters. Saddle stitch binding works well for smaller documents, while thicker books require glued or sewn spines. Mechanical bindings can handle a wide range of page counts but may not offer the same polished look.

Budget is another key factor. Softcover vs hardcover binding often comes down to cost. Hardcover books require more materials and labor, while softcover options are more affordable but less durable.

User experience is equally important. Manuals benefit from bindings that lie flat, while books meant for reading prioritize comfort and portability. Matching the binding to the user’s needs ensures better results.

Materials and construction behind durable binding

Materials play a major role in how well a book holds up over time. Even the best structure can fail if low-quality components are used.

Hardcover books use dense paperboard for protection, often wrapped in cloth or laminated paper. These materials resist bending and protect the pages. Softcover books use flexible cover stock, which lowers cost but reduces durability.

Adhesives are critical in many binding methods. Perfect binding relies on glue, and stronger adhesives improve performance. Polyurethane adhesives offer better resistance to heat and wear than standard options.

Thread is essential in sewn bindings. Smyth sewn binding uses strong thread to connect sections, creating a flexible spine that handles repeated use. This reduces stress on individual pages.

Additional elements such as endpapers and spine linings help reinforce the structure. Together, these components determine how well a book performs in real-world conditions.

Matching binding types to real world projects

Choosing the right binding depends on the project’s purpose. Matching the method to real-world use ensures better performance and cost efficiency.

Saddle stitch binding is ideal for brochures and short catalogs. It is affordable and efficient for high-volume printing where longevity is not critical.

Perfect binding books work well for catalogs, reports, and paperbacks. They offer a professional look at a moderate cost, making them a common choice for commercial printing.

Spiral coil binding for books and Wire-O binding for books are best for manuals and training guides. These formats allow pages to lie flat, improving usability in practical settings.

For long-term or high-value projects, case binding for hardcover books and Smyth sewn binding provide the highest durability. These methods are suited for textbooks, reference materials, and archival publications.

Aligning the binding choice with the project’s needs leads to better results.
